 MBBS Program Overview

Degree Awarded: Bachelor of Medicine and Bachelor of Surgery (MBBS)

Duration: 5.5 years (4.5 years academic + 1-year compulsory rotating internship)

Recognition: Approved by NMC and recognized globally

Medium of Instruction: English and regional languages (depending on state/college)

 Admission Requirements

Completion of 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Biology

Minimum 50% in PCB (40% for reserved categories)

NEET qualification is mandatory

State or central counseling for seat allotment

4

Fee Structure

Government Colleges: ₹20,000 to ₹1 lakh per year

Private Colleges: ₹5 lakhs to ₹25 lakhs per year

Deemed Universities: Varies, generally higher

Scholarships and reserved category benefits available
